So I did a little searching for a mail toy for him and low and behold here it is.
No surprise, it’s from Melissa & Doug, the king of wooden toys and puzzles. The hand-painted mailbox set, $39.95, comes with six different shaped letters that correspond to slots in the box. There’s also stamps that Velcro on to the letters and a key to open the box when it’s full. If only my two-year-old could write out the Christmas cards, I’d be in good shape.
